Overview
Standardized testing has been a cornerstone of educational assessment for decades, providing a uniform measure to evaluate student performance across diverse demographics. These tests, often administered at state and national levels, aim to ensure accountability in education and provide data for policymakers. Recent discussions highlight the dual nature of standardized tests: while they can offer insights into educational equity, they also face scrutiny regarding their effectiveness in truly measuring student understanding and potential. For instance, a recent study published in the Academic Journal of Education raised questions about the validity of these tests, suggesting they may not accurately reflect a student's capabilities. Meanwhile, innovative approaches are emerging, such as a local school district's pilot program focusing on critical thinking skills in test preparation, showcasing a positive shift towards more holistic educational practices.
The Role of Standardized Testing
Standardized testing has played a significant role in shaping educational assessment practices. These tests are designed to provide a consistent measure of student performance, enabling comparisons across different schools and districts. However, the effectiveness of standardized tests is increasingly being questioned. Recent studies suggest that these assessments may not fully capture a student's understanding or potential, leading to calls for reform and alternative assessment methods.
Innovations in Test Preparation
In response to growing concerns, some educational institutions are exploring innovative approaches to test preparation. For example, a local school district has begun piloting new methods that emphasize critical thinking skills rather than rote memorization. This shift reflects a broader trend towards more holistic educational practices, aiming to better prepare students for real-world challenges.
